Research On The Grey Balanced Model Of Shaanxi Coordination Development

The sustainable development is the subject of the development nowadays in the world, the core of which is the natural and sociaty's coordination development, the contant is population, resourse, environment and economy. They affected and influenced each other, by which composite a dynatic and free and complicated system. To make the four part develope coordinationly, we should evaluate the coordination of the system first, and then, we can apprasel a tragitic of the four parts developing coordinationly and foresee the future of the coordination of the four parts. Therefor, to analysis the coordination of populatin, resourse, environment and ecomoncs is full of means and very important.Grey System Theory, which studies the uncertain system on the "small sample", "poor information", i.e. "partial information known, partial information unknown" we have. Through creating and excavating the limited information, we could understand the real world, describe its evolvement rule and grasp its running behavior exactly.This paper studied on Shannxi province's population, resourse, economics and environment sub-system and the relationship of the four sub-system, to make the sub-system coordination by using grey system science and theory to analysis Shannxi's level of coordination. Firstly, this paper created a system to evaluate the level of coordination. Secondly, using grey synthetic appraisal to get the develop level of Shannxi's population, economics, environment and resourse in the year of 2000-2005. Thirdly, using balanced theory and grey relational analysis theory separately to appraisal the level of coordination in Shannxi develop during the year of 2000-2005. Fourthly, using GM(1,N) model to analysis the sub-system's coordination of develop.
